Zilker Botanical Garden

Zilker Botanical Garden is a 26-acre garden located in the heart of Austin. It is a popular spot for couples to take a romantic stroll and enjoy the beautiful scenery. The garden features a variety of themed gardens, including a rose garden, a Japanese garden, and a herb garden. Couples can also take a scenic walk along the garden’s many trails or enjoy a picnic in one of the garden’s many picnic areas.

Mount Bonnell

Mount Bonnell is one of the highest points in Austin and offers stunning views of the city. It is a popular spot for couples to watch the sunset and enjoy a romantic picnic. The climb to the top of Mount Bonnell is a bit steep, but the views are well worth the effort. Couples can also take a scenic walk along the trail that runs along the base of the mountain.

Lady Bird Lake

Lady Bird Lake is a popular spot for couples to enjoy a romantic paddleboat ride or take a scenic walk along the lake’s many trails. The lake offers stunning views of the Austin skyline and is a great place to watch the sunset. Couples can also rent a kayak or paddleboard and explore the lake’s many coves and inlets.

Food Truck Tastings

Food trucks are a popular dining option in Austin, and they offer a unique culinary experience for couples. Some of the most popular food trucks in Austin include East Side King, Torchy’s Tacos, and Chi’Lantro. These food trucks offer a variety of cuisines, from Mexican to Korean fusion, and are perfect for a casual date night.

Fine Dining Experiences

For couples looking for a more upscale dining experience, Austin has plenty of fine dining options. Uchi is a popular Japanese restaurant that offers a romantic atmosphere and a menu of innovative sushi and other Japanese dishes. Other popular fine dining options in Austin include Jeffrey’s, Emmer & Rye, and Olamaie.

Brewery and Winery Tours

Austin is home to a number of breweries and wineries, and taking a tour of these facilities can be a fun and romantic date idea. Some popular breweries in Austin include Austin Beerworks, Jester King Brewery, and Hops & Grain. For wine lovers, a visit to the Texas Hill Country wineries is a must. Some popular wineries in the area include Becker Vineyards, Duchman Family Winery, and Fall Creek Vineyards.

Live Music Venues

Austin is known as the “Live Music Capital of the World,” so it’s no surprise that there are plenty of great venues to choose from. For a romantic night out, consider checking out one of the many intimate venues in town. The Continental Club is a classic choice, with a cozy atmosphere and a diverse lineup of musicians. The Cactus Cafe is another great option, with a focus on singer-songwriters and acoustic music. For something a little more upscale, try the Elephant Room, a jazz club that has been a staple of the Austin music scene for over 25 years.

Museum Date Nights

For a more low-key evening, consider a museum date night. Many of Austin’s museums offer special events and exhibitions after hours, making for a unique and romantic experience. The Blanton Museum of Art hosts a monthly event called “B scene,” which features live music, food, and drinks. The Thinkery, a children’s museum, offers an adults-only event called “Thinkery21,” which includes science experiments, cocktails, and food trucks. For a more traditional museum experience, check out the Texas State History Museum, which offers a variety of exhibits on Texas history and culture.

Gallery Hopping

Austin is home to a thriving art scene, with galleries and art spaces scattered throughout the city. Gallery hopping is a great way to explore the city and discover new artists together. The East Austin Studio Tour, which takes place every November, is a great way to see a variety of galleries and studios in one weekend. For a more curated experience, check out the Contemporary Austin, which has two locations and features a rotating selection of contemporary art. The Yard is another great option, with a variety of galleries and creative spaces all in one location.

Sunset Bat Watching

Austin is home to the largest urban bat colony in North America, and watching these creatures take flight at sunset is a truly unique experience. Couples can head to the Congress Avenue Bridge to witness the bats emerge from under the bridge and take to the skies. It’s a romantic and unforgettable way to spend an evening together.

Couples Spa Retreat

For a more relaxing and indulgent experience, couples can book a spa retreat at one of Austin’s many luxurious spas. From massages to facials to hot tubs and saunas, there are plenty of options for couples looking to unwind and pamper themselves. Some popular spas in Austin include Milk + Honey, Viva Day Spa, and Lake Austin Spa Resort.

Hot Air Balloon Rides

For a truly breathtaking and romantic experience, couples can take to the skies in a hot air balloon ride over the beautiful Texas Hill Country. Many companies offer hot air balloon rides in the Austin area, and some even include champagne and a private breakfast or dinner.
